An earlier report that said Christian Atsu had been found under the rubble was as a case of mistaken identity.

Now, we hear that the former Newcastle winger is still missing after an earthquake in Turkey.

Advertisements

Volkan Demirel, director at Christian Atsu’s club Hatayspor told Reuters on Wednesday, February 8, 2023 that the player had still not been located after it had been announced he’d been pulled from the rubble and taken to hospital, following the huge earthquakes which have devastated parts of Turkey and neighbouring Syria.

“There is no information on his whereabouts yet, we don’t know where he is,” Demirel said.

Advertisements

“It’s not the case that he was pulled out or taken anywhere else.”

“The search for Atsu is ongoing”, Demirel added. Christian Atsu joined Turkish Super Lig side Hatayspor in September 2022 after spending nearly a decade at Chelsea and Newcastle United.

Christian Atsu is still missing

Christian Atsu was reported missing after team-mates and members of the club’s technical staff had reportedly been pulled from the rubble.

More than 10,000 people have been killed after a 7.8 magnitude earthquake hit south-eastern Turkey and northern Syria during the early hours of Monday morning, followed by a second of 7.5.

The agent for Christian Atsu, the former Premier League soccer player who was reportedly pulled from the rubble of a collapsed building after an earthquake struck Turkey and Syria on Monday, said on Wednesday that he could not locate his client.

Atsu was part of the Newcastle team which won promotion back to the Premier League in 2017 after joining on loan for the season from Chelsea, and later completed a permanent move. He also had brief spells at Everton and Bournemouth on a temporary basis.

Turkish goalkeeper Ahmet Eyup Turkaslan died following Monday’s earthquake in the country.
